CHARLOTTE, N.C. — Panthers quarterback Cam Newton released a video on his YouTube channel Friday addressing why he’s sidelined.

He said he realized pregame before the season opener versus the Los Angeles Rams that he couldn’t run.

He said he’s doing everything he can to get back. He said whether it's a week or six weeks, he just wants to make sure he’s 100%.

Newton confirmed he’s dealing with a Lisfranc injury, which happens when a bone breaks in the mid-foot or ligaments tear, causing joint instability.
